Restaurant Manager Jobs in British Columbia

A Restaurant Manager is a crucial player in the hospitality industry, responsible for the overall operation of a restaurant or dining facility. This involves a wide range of tasks, including staff management, inventory control, customer service, marketing, and financial management. They ensure that the restaurant operates efficiently and profitably, while fostering a positive work environment. They are responsible for maintaining high production, productivity, quality, and customer-service standards.

Key skills required for a restaurant manager include leadership, communication, problem-solving, and decision-making skills. They should also have a thorough understanding of food safety principles and should ideally hold a Food Safety Handler certification. Critical financial skills, such as budgeting and financial analysis, are also beneficial. Prior roles that could lead to a restaurant management position include roles as a Restaurant Supervisor, Assistant Manager, or even a Head Chef. These positions offer invaluable experience in managing staff, dealing with customers, and understanding restaurant operations.
